Re: dzVents 1.0 released
Ah, it took me a little but it should be variable.value (lowercase)fergalom wrote:Query on my code:
I have a number (39) of user variables being populated from an alarm system with the values "ok" or "alarm"
I want to monitor them for the "alarm" value and if "alarm" I want to turn on a switch in domoticz and send a notification
This is my code:Code: Select all
return { active = true , on = { 'timer' }, execute = function(domoticz) domoticz.variables.forEach(function(variable) local switched = false print(variable.Value) if (variable.Value == 'alarm') then domoticz.devices['Alarm Triggered'].switchOn() domoticz.notify('Alarm triggered Event Test!', '', domoticz.PRIORITY_EMERGENCY) else print(variable.value) if (switched == false) then domoticz.devices['Alarm Triggered'].switchOff() switched = true end end end) end }
And I would alter the script a bit not to flood Domoticz with unnecessary commands:
Code: Select all
return {
active = true ,
on = { 'timer' },
execute = function(domoticz)
local alarmTrigger = domoticz.devices['Alarm Triggered']
local switchCmd = 'Off'
domoticz.variables.forEach(function(variable)
if (variable.value == 'alarm') then
switchCmd = 'On'
end
end)
if (switchCmd == 'On' and alarmTrigger.state == 'Off') then
alarmTrigger.switchOn()
domoticz.notify('Alarm triggered Event Test!', '', domoticz.PRIORITY_EMERGENCY)
elseif (alarmTrigger.state == 'On') then
-- only switchOff if it was On
alarmTrigger.switchOff()
end
end
}

Re: dzVents 1.0 released
Unfortunately not. Domoticz doesn't throw an event and triggers scripts when a variable changes. Only if you change the variable from the UI.
I do have plans though to have this work for dzVents persistent variables and have other scripts create triggers for when global variables change.
What triggers the updating of these variables in your case? Coz if your alarm system could toggle a dummy switch instead of setting a variable, then you'r done. You can have a script that is triggered if any of these dummy switches is toggled.

Re: dzVents 1.0 released
Hi,
just pushing a pull request for leaking detection.
I hope it'll be usefull for someone
guiguid
just pushing a pull request for leaking detection.
Code: Select all
-- Water leak detection
--
-- assumptions:
-- need 2 devices :
-- a Water Flow devices name "Water_Flow"
-- a Dummy Device type percentage "Leakage_Percent"
--
-- 1 / leakage "open valve"
-- Every minute if a non-zero water flow is present, it incerments a counter (Leakage_Percent)
-- If the water flow is zero is that it leaks more continuously.
-- A notification can be put on "Leakage_Percent" if >80% (80% = 80 minutes of continuous flow)
--
-- 2 / "micro continuous flow" (drip)
-- in 24 hours one must have at least 2 hours without flow (detection 0.5 liters / hour is 4.5m3 / year)
-- if not, "Leakage_Percent" is forced at 100%.
local FLOW_DEVICE = 'Water_Flow' -- Flow device
local LEAK_DEVICE = 'Leakage_Percent' -- percent dummy device
return {
active = true,
on = {
['timer'] = 'every minute'
},
data = {
time_0_flow = { initial = 0 },
total_time = { initial = 0 },
},
execute = function(domoticz)
-- Flow in liter/minute
local flow = tonumber(domoticz.devices[FLOW_DEVICE].rawData[1])
-- Dummy device in %
local leakage = domoticz.devices[LEAK_DEVICE]
local time_with_flow = tonumber(leakage.rawData[1])
local new_time_with_flow = time_with_flow
-- 1 / leakage "open valve"
if (flow > 0) then
domoticz.data.time_0_flow = 0 -- there is a flow
new_time_with_flow = new_time_with_flow + 1 -- time with flow
if (new_time_with_flow > 100) then
new_time_with_flow = 100
end
else
new_time_with_flow = 0
domoticz.data.time_0_flow = domoticz.data.time_0_flow + 1 -- time without flow
end
-- 2 / flight type "micro continuous flow" (drip)
domoticz.data.total_time = domoticz.data.total_time + 1 -- time without since last 2 hours with no flow
if (domoticz.data.time_0_flow > 120) then
-- 2 hours with no flow
domoticz.data.total_time = 0
elseif (domoticz.data.total_time > (60*24)) then
-- 24 heures since last 2 hours with no flow
new_time_with_flow = 100
end
-- log
domoticz.log(new_time_with_flow .. ' minutes with flow ')
domoticz.log(domoticz.data.time_0_flow .. ' minutes without flow ')
domoticz.log(domoticz.data.total_time .. ' minutes witout 2hrs witout flow ')
-- update dummy device %
if (time_with_flow ~= new_time_with_flow) then
leakage.update(0,new_time_with_flow)
end
end
}
